Alright so I have been reading through the P3 forum here and noticing a lot of people claiming the older FW 1.5.7 is better than the new 1.6.8. When I purchased my drone (5/4/16) I took it out of the box and allowed everything to fully update, so I was running 1.6.8 OTB. Upon flying it for a 2 weeks and reaching around 2200 ft within my neighborhood( 2500 homes, avg lot is .7 acre and EVERYONE has high end routers as well as above ground power lines surrounding the greater are) so last night I downgraded the drone to 1.5.7 and decided to see if I could get better range. I can't make it past 650ft now without having to hold the controller up and simply turn around to re-gain connection. I came back inside and upgraded back to 1.6.8 and threw in a new battery and went for a flight..... My first flight I hit 2450ft before connection started to weaken, flew it back and did it again. The drone performs superb on FW 1.6.8 and I will not be downgrading again! My FPVLR long range antenna kit is on the way and I'll post pictures and results upon receiving it!

First, I'm happy that you were able to downgrade and then upgrade successfully.

I find that information pretty interesting and it actually reinforces what many others complain of when they upgrade their firmware. I experienced the exact opposite with the same two firmware versions on my P3S. When I upgraded to 1.6.8, it rendered my drone pretty much useless beyond 200 feet (sometimes 50 feet). Switching back to 1.5.7 completely restored my performance. There is something weird going on here. Some people experience terrible results with a particular upgrade while the majority, it seems, do not. Don't know if it's different hardware or that DJI's upgrade process has some bugs in it. Either way, I think DJI should investigate and fix the problems, instead of denying that anything is wrong, telling us how to point our antennas, and saying we need to send our drones back for repair, at which point it becomes our fault and we are charged for repair, or at the very least, pay to send it to the repair center. I also find that it's pretty strange that they would never provide a method of downgrading the firmware. This only resulted in some pretty angry customers.

I have so many sd cards, i just downloaded the FW from phantomhelp, threw it on the sd card... connected controller to app... turned on drone with SD card in it... and it downgraded itself! same to re-upgrade
